One person died in the fire that ravaged a building in Aubange on the night of Tuesday to Wednesday. Local authorities quickly secured the area, the damage is significant.

On the night of Tuesday to Wednesday, a major fire ravaged a building located at 12 Avenue de la Gares in Aubange. The mayor, François Kinard, confirmed that one person lost his life. Four residents were in the building when the fire started. One of them, affected by this fire, went to the CPAS on Wednesday morning to get help. The other two were rehoused with their family.

Firefighters from Aubange, Arlon and Virton, as well as a vehicle from Paliseul, were dispatched to the scene. This Wednesday morning, at 8:15 am, the firefighters were still on site.

The disaster completely destroyed the first floor and the roof of the building. The teams from the City of Aubange, in particular the works department, quickly mobilized to secure the premises. Around twenty Nadar barriers were installed to allow children to get to school safely this morning. The mayor praised their responsiveness in the face of this tragic situation. François Kinard confirms that the independent school is indeed open this Wednesday morning.

The Luxembourg Public Prosecutor’s Office was notified at around 4:00 a.m. The on-call magistrate asked the laboratory and a fire expert to come to the scene, but the body was still inaccessible this morning due to the temperature linked to the fire. Depending on the nature of the fire, other duties could be requested.
